[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: nginx и post-запросы



Dmitry E. Oboukhov <unera@debian.org> wrote:
> есть такая задача


> нечто вроде того что делаем POST http://url/имя.файла.txt, а на деле
> вызывается CGI который отдает содержимое файла. Эта фигня используется
> чтобы "обмануть" старые браузеры и заставить их скачивать корректные
> имена файлов.
Эээ, может правильней писать - корявые скрипты, авторы которых не асилили
правильно выдать имя файла? Или у вас документально завялена поддержка
Misaic и HTTP/0.9 до скончания веков задарма?

> так вот, location'ов на все такие места прописывать слишком много
> (надо разгребать что там пользователи в подкаталогах с .htaccess
> намутили), а можно ли nginx заставить всегда проксировать POST-запросы?
Заставить то можно, только внимание вопрос - а нафига в этой схеме nginx? 
Нонче круто всё делать чрез nginx?


PS: Предвидя праведные вопли "если вам нефиг сказать - чо лезем", отвечаю -
если бы чукча умел читать документацию и не был бы забанен на гугле - то найти
кусок конфига с использованием try_files (http://forum.nginx.org/read.php?2,4893,4924)
смог бы сам, но - увы.

PPS: Да, идея отдавать через cgi то, что можно отдать nginx'ом через
X-Accel-Redirect - ущербна еще более... Впрочем - поддержка cgi в наше вермя
вобще смахивает на бред сумашедшего.


Reply to: